As Agile Delivery Manager (ADM) you will be at the forefront of the project acting as lead technical contact and working with multi-disciplinary, creative teams who embrace challenge and seek opportunities to do things differently. This is an instrumental role in which you will be responsible for maintaining a strong agile culture, working iteratively to achieve effective delivery at pace, managing relationships within and across teams and communicating the product vision, plan and progress to stakeholders with both confidence and drive.

You will lead the collaborative planning process, prioritising work against team capacity and designing methods to promote an open and collaborative working environment in which the team and stakeholders have a strong situational awareness, with team co-ordination ensured.

Working closely with the Product Owner, you will take a continuous delivery approach to manage planning, forecasting and road mapping, creating metrics and contributing to writing user stories. You’ll be able to work autonomously within this learning culture, be a strong negotiator, influencer and mentor, building a dedicated and positive team.
